Most trees in the Westhampton area benefit from trimming during late fall through early spring when they’re dormant. This timing reduces stress on the tree and minimizes the risk of disease transmission. However, dead or dangerous branches should be removed immediately regardless of season. Some species like maples and birches are better trimmed in late spring to avoid excessive sap bleeding. Proper tree trimming actually improves tree health and longevity when done correctly by trained professionals. We follow industry standards for pruning cuts, timing, and removal amounts to promote healthy growth. Poor trimming techniques like topping or removing too much foliage at once can harm trees, which is why professional service matters. Our approach focuses on selective removal of problematic branches while preserving the tree’s natural structure and ability to photosynthesize effectively.

Most mature trees benefit from professional evaluation and trimming every 3-5 years, though this varies by species, age, and growing conditions. Younger trees may need more frequent attention to establish proper structure, while some slow-growing species require less frequent maintenance. Trees near structures or in high-traffic areas often need more regular attention for safety reasons.
